An illumination slide is held 44 cm from a screen. In order to have an image of the slide's picture on the screen three times the size of the picture, how far from the slide must a converging lens be placed and what focal length it should have? _The answer is __11 cm and 8.25 cm. How do you get this?

Explanation / Answer
let the distance be x.so,
3=v/u
or v=3x.so,
3x+x=44
or x=11
so it should be at a distance of 11 cm
or (1/x)+(1/3x)=1/f
or f=8.25 cm
